"Isotron" validity in different word game dictionaries

Dictionary Validity
Scrabble US(US/Canada/Thailand - TWL/NWL) No
Scrabble UK(International - SOWPODS/CSW) Yes
Words with Friends(WWF) No

"isotron" Definition

  1. an electromagnetic apparatus for separating isotopes introduced as ions from an extended source which group according to their masses under the combined effect of a strong direct field and weak fields that vary at radio frequency

7 Letter Words Finder ->All length

Letters in specific positions
Do not contain letters

7 Letter Words Starting With

7 Letter Words Ending In